Definitions:

Long-Term Oriented

A focus or perspective that emphasizes planning and prioritizing future rewards over immediate outcomes.

High Power Distance

A term from cultural dimensions theory referring to the degree to which less powerful members of organizations within a country expect and accept that power is distributed unequally.

Uncertainty Avoidance

A cultural dimension that describes the extent to which societies are comfortable with ambiguity, uncertainty, and unstructured situations.

Collectivist Ideals

Principles that prioritize the needs and goals of the group over individual desires and achievements.
